Shells & Shellfish Salad







Ingredients:

450 grams medium-sized conchiglie

1 cup mayonnaise

2 tbspoon fresh milk

500 grams cooked shellfish flesh: shrimp,crab meat, etc.

½ green pepper, ½ red pepper, ½ orange pepper

Fresh lemon juice

Salt, freshly ground black pepper

Method:

Cook pasta in boiling salted water till soft. Drain,rinse under cold water and drain dry.

In a mixing bowl, pour in mayonnaise, fresh milk, lemon juice, grounded pepper. Mix till even. Pour in cooked pasta and shellfish and mix till well blended. Add in green,red and orange pepper to add flavor and color to it. Serve chilled.

10th October 2009. This was a remarkable day as The Liews, The Lee and The Lim made a point to run and pray for our beloved country, Malaysia. The team members were Harry, Po Yen, CK, Ben & Tim. They took with them the road map and prayer cards for the 5km prayer run.

Po Yen injured his toe two days before the date and hence could not run. Nevertheless, the desire to pray was there and he joined them in prayers while driving along with the runners.

I was the appointed Team Manager (i.e time keeper, water supplier, photographer and driver). I am proud to have been able to contribute to this run. Hopefully, the next round I would sign up as a runner too! We were very glad to have Michelle (a second year medical student) who came along as the medic.

Our team, AG14 team 4, managed to complete the route without any incident and hand over the prayer cards to the next team to carrying on with the vision.
